The Embody was designed for the desk-all-day worker — pixelated backrest that follows your spine, articulating arms, narrow seat. Originally Studio 7.5 / Bill Stumpf project from 2008. Still in production. New it's ~£1,600. Used Grade A: we pay £200, resells around £450–£550. Always in demand from start-ups specifying premium without the budget.
